Abstract

The utility model discloses a degradable magnesium alloy stapling nail for a medical stapler. The degradable magnesium alloy stapling nail for the medical stapler comprises a stapling nail body made of magnesium alloy in a pressure casting mode and of a pi shape, wherein the stapling nail body in the pi shape is provided with a strip of nail body, two vertical conical nails are formed at two ends of the nail body, a transverse rib and a guide groove are formed on the nail body, and a barb is carved at the inner side of each vertical conical nail formed at two ends of the nail body. According to the degradable magnesium alloy stapling nail for the medical stapler, the vertical conical nails are formed at two ends of the nail body of the stapling nail body, the transverse rib is formed on the surface of the nail body, so that when the stapler is used for sewing human tissue or an organ, the stapler is stabbed into the human tissue or the organ easily, the stapling operation is rapid, a wound is small, and pain caused by suture can be relieved. Besides, the degradable magnesium alloy stapling nail for the medical stapler has enough suture strength, the barbs are respectively carved at the inner sides of the vertical conical nails formed at two ends of the nail body, so that the degradable magnesium alloy stapling nail is firmly combined with the human tissue or the organ, and the absorption and the degradation speed of the magnesium alloy stapling nail are quickened along with the heal of the wound.

Background technology
Along with the development of medical science technology, the doctor carries out tissue or organ is sewed up, and from original mode with the needlework manual suture, changes the mode of sewing up with medical anastomat and alloy anastomosis staple into.Use medical anastomat to sew up, be convenient to operation, the wound of coincide safely, bringing is very little, is accepted by vast surgical clinical doctor.But the used anastomosis staple of existing medical anastomat mostly adopts titanium alloy to make, because the titanium alloy corrosion resistance is higher relatively, sew up back titanium alloy anastomosis staple and can stay for a long time in tissue or the organ, might cause inflammation, make the people that not very comfortable sensation always be arranged.The someone adopts the magnesium alloy of absorbable and degradable to make anastomosis staple for this reason, as patent " CN200920256518.6 " disclosed " anastomat is followed closely with the Absorbale magnesium alloy seam ", wish to utilize the characteristic of magnesium alloy materials absorbable and degradable exactly, allow and stay in tissue or the organ magnesium alloy seam nail after sewing up along with the slowly healing of wound, be degraded or fragmentation is fallen, or be absorbed by the body.Because seam nail " U " shape shaft of making of magnesium alloy all is coated with the face coat of corrosion resistance, so make its degraded or absorb relatively long speed also not too satisfactory.

The specific embodiment
Below in conjunction with the drawings and specific embodiments this utility model is elaborated.
A kind of medical anastomat degradable magnesium alloy anastomosis staple, as depicted in figs. 1 and 2, comprise a body with " П " shape anastomosis staple of magnesium alloy materials die casting, the body of described " П " shape anastomosis staple is provided with a nail body 1, mold two vertical awl nails 2 in nail body 1 two ends, form a horizontal bar 3 on the face of nail body 1, form a gathering sill 4 below, vertical awl nail 2 inboard engraving tools of described nail body 1 two ends molding have barb 5.
This utility model medical treatment anastomat degradable magnesium alloy anastomosis staple, mold two vertical awl nails 2 at nail body 1 two ends of anastomosis staple body, make when using anastomat to sew up tissue or organ, anastomosis staple is highly susceptible to thrusting tissue or organ, allowing coincide operates rapidly, safety, not only wound is very little, also can reduce and sew up the pain of bringing; 1 horizontal bar 3 of going up molding of nail body, also improved the suture strength of anastomosis staple body, vertical awl nail 2 inboard engraving tools of nail body 1 two ends molding have barb 5, make the vertical awl nail 2 that enters tissue or organ after the stitching with it in conjunction with more firm, can not break away from easily because of hyperkinesia is subjected to external force.
When this utility model uses, will encapsulate earlier in the nail groove that anastomosis staple in a row is enclosed in anastomat, the gathering sill 4 of molding can be realized accurately locating for the installation of anastomosis staple and moving forward gradually when identical below the nail body 1.
Because the vertical awl nail 2 of this utility model anastomosis staple body is taper, therefore uses it to carry out the stitching of tissue or organ, help realizing returning to one's perfect health of sick body along with wound healing is accelerated the absorption of magnesium alloy anastomosis staple in the body and the speed of degraded.
